“Byju’s Begins Settling Dues with BCCI, Transfers ₹500 Million as First Payment”

Byju’s, the cash-strapped ed-tech company, is moving towards resolving its financial dispute with the Board of Control for Cricket in India (BCCI). The company has made an initial payment of ₹500 million to the cricket board, according to reports. Byju’s Appeals Against Insolvency, Faces Crucial NCLAT Hearing Amid Financial Turmoil

Byju’s, India’s leading tech giant once valued at $22 billion, is navigating turbulent waters as it appeals against insolvency proceedings initiated by the Board of Control for Cricket in India (BCCI).
